This re-sAviestion-;hall alsoe apply to the planting oferops an <br /> to yard gr-ades that restilt in eleva4iens that impede vision within fifteen(15)feet of any interseeting <br /> stFeet Fight of way lines. <br /> (M 1( 0) Motor Vehicle Parking in Residential and Rural Zoning Districts. <br /> (a) Passenger motor vehicles,including cars,pickup trucks,vans,and motorcycles may <br /> be parked on a residential or rural property provided that: <br /> 1. They are parked on an appropriate surface in compliance with Section <br /> 1007.044(3)(h)16. <br /> 2. They are operable and appropriately licensed at all times they are parked outside <br /> of an accessory structure. <br /> 3. They are setback a minimum of five feet from side and rear property lines, <br /> except in cases where a shared driveway has been approved by the city engineer. <br /> 4. When parked in the front yard or corner side yard of a property,they are parked <br /> on a designated driveway or parking area. <br /> (b) Recreational Vehicles and Trailers,as defined by§1007.001 of this Ordinance may <br /> be parked or stored on a residential site provided that: <br /> 1. The vehicles are registered to or rented by a resident of the dwelling on such site, <br /> provided that: <br /> a. The vehicles have affixed thereto current registration or license plates as <br /> required by law. <br /> b. The vehicles are stored no closer than five(5)feet from side and rear lot lines. <br /> c. The vehicles located within front yard areas are confined to designated <br /> driveways or parking areas surfaced in compliance with§1007.044(11)(a)1. <br /> 2. All front yard storage comply with the following setbacks from street curb and <br /> pavement lines: <br /> Street Classification Minimum setback from <br /> curb/pavement line <br /> Major Arterial 30 feet <br /> 3-65 <br />
